    In Sarbiewski's Circle − Albert Ines' Lyric Poetry

    No full text
    Albert Ines is discussed here as the author of the lyrical poem Lyricorum centuriae (Gdańsk 1655). In the collection there are many religious poems, especially ones taking up Virgin Mary as their subject matter, and hence Ines is described as vates Marianus. Ines' religious poems are bound by a double convention: that of the use of biblical and ancient metaphors; they are also even ”garrulous” because of motives of praise accumulated in a litany-style manner. His reflective poems are more interesting; they are a kind of intellectual-lyric poetry abouding in clever sayings, pointed antitheses, etc. Ines imitates Sarbiewski but being consistent with the rule ”imitari non expilare” he limits himself to only two ”parodies”; and even they are not very typical. The fact that Ines imitates Sarbiewski is also seen in taking up the same subjects in his poems. This similarity is sometimes rather faint so its significance for our interpretation will be limited

    The Story of Sor Juana Ines de la Cruz

    No full text
    abstract: The story of Sor Juana Ines de la Cruz is one of a woman who defied the odds of her time. Sor Juana was a nun born in the 1600's in Mexico. From an early start, she had an endless passion for knowledge and always strove to learn as much as she could. She went on to become a nun at the Convent of Santa Paula and used her intellect to advocate for women's rights. Though met with opposition, she wrote many poems, letters, and even plays which included her strong push for women's equality. However, the name Sor Juana Ines de la Cruz is almost never mentioned in popular feminist discourse, despite Sor Juana being credited as one of the first feminist authors. This paper works to not only tell the story of Sor Juana Ines de la Cruz in detail, but also works to answer the question, "Why do people not know about Sor Juana". By diving into the origins of the Feminist movement in the United States, the dark underbelly of Feminism is uncovered. Primarily, the topic of how racism in feminism has plague the civil rights movement, what damage has been done to people of color because of feminism's history, and how does that pertain to modern day feminism and Sor Juana. By telling her story through both written and visual aids, the voice of Sor Juana Ines de la Cruz is no longer silenced but free to tell her tale and move a generation

    Démantèlement de composites stratifiés par choc laser pour des applications de réutilisation

    No full text
    Carbon fibre reinforced polymers (CFRPs) are widely used in aerospace, wind energy, and sports applications due to their excellent specific mechanical properties and the reduction in emissions made possible by lightweight structures. However, a significant amount of composite waste is generated each year, coming from production or end-of-life structures, raising major challenges in terms of recycling and sustainability. Recycling and reusing continuous-fibre composites represent promising solutions to reduce the carbon footprint. Nevertheless, conventional methods, whether mechanical, chemical, or thermal, often lead to fibre degradation, the production of pollutants, or insufficient quality of the recovered materials.This thesis proposes a novel process based on laser shock dismantling at the ply scale. High-energy nanosecond laser pulses generate shock waves at the surface of the material, inducing localized delamination. Unlike traditional approaches that aim to separate individual constituents, this technique allows the recovery of entire plies or groups of plies while preserving fibre length, a key advantage for high-performance reuse. The recovered materials can be directly reused in less demanding applications or indirectly through reassembly of the dismantled plies via structural bonding.Additionally, this work investigates the effect of ageing on composites. Oxidation layers on the resin and composite are characterized, and the influence of ageing on laser parameters is analyzed to allow selective removal of oxidized plies. Moreover, a guided-wave monitoring method (SHM) is developed with a dual purpose: detecting structural changes due to ageing, enabling early assessment of natural degradation, and controlling the dismantling in real time by detecting delamination events and quantifying the affected areas.This multidisciplinary work demonstrates that laser shock dismantling, combined with the study of ageing and in situ SHM monitoring, provides an effective pathway for the recovery and reuse of composite materials while minimizing their environmental impact.Les polymères renforcés de fibres de carbone (CFRP) sont largement utilisés dans l’aéronautique, l’énergie éolienne et le sport, grâce à leurs excellentes propriétés mécaniques spécifiques et à la réduction des émissions rendue possible par les structures allégées.     Growth, genes, genomes: iInsights into microbial respiration of arsenic and selenium

    No full text
    Arsenic (As) and selenium (Se) are naturally occurring metalloids in the Earth’s crust. Their speciation is governed by the microbial communities in various environments which influences their mobility among the soil, water, and air interface. Microorganisms can utilize As and Se oxyanion as terminal electron acceptors in dissimilatory reduction. These organisms are ubiquitous and phylogenetically diverse. The objectives of the studies in this thesis were to gain an understanding of the metabolism of As and Se respiring bacteria, analyze the genes encoding enzymes involved in respiration and understand how these enzymes are regulated in the presence of various electron acceptors. We were able to isolate two novel As and Se respiring bacteria from different environments; from a wastewater treatment facility in Verona, NJ and an estuarine canal from Chennai, India. Based on 16S rRNA gene analysis, strain S4 was classified as a novel genus and species, Selenovibrio woodruffi and strain S5 as a novel species, Desulfurispirillum indicum. We analyzed the genome of D. indicum and examined the expression of putative reductases to further understand respiratory metabolism of As and Se oxyanions. Five molybdoenzyme genes were identified in the genome of strain S5, three of which we were annotated to encode for a respiratory arsenate reductase arr, periplasmic nitrate reductase nar, and respiratory nitrate reductase nap. Also, an arsenate resistance system, ars, was identified. We were not able to positively identify a selenate reductase gene. Gene expression studies revealed that arr was an inducible gene and the only gene highly expressed during arsenate respiration. Growth studies showed that selenate respiration was inhibited by nitrate. Lastly, we also enriched activated sludge samples for tellurium oxyanion respiring bacteria. Thus, we not only added novel, phylogenetically different organisms to the ever-increasing list of As and Se respiring microbes, we also provided insights into the genes and enzymes involved in As and Se respiration and how they are regulated.Ph.
